Burst Pipe Water Removal Cost in Canyon Lake, AZ
The cost of Burst Pipe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Canyon Lake, AZ.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age on-site.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water involved. |
| Sanitation and Disinfection |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the contamination and the number of surfaces that need to be disinfected.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the type of repairs needed. |
| Equipment Rental and Labor | $500 – $2,000 | The type and quantity of equipment needed, as well as the number of labor hours required. |
| Insurance and Administrative Fees | $100 – $500 | The type of insurance coverage and the administrative costs associated with the claim. |
The final cost will depend on the specifics of your situation, including the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Canyon Lake, AZ.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age on-site.
